The bug
If you put a sheep into a box of tinted glass blocks, it's rendered like if it were a white sheared sheep (even for other color sheep). That happens only for pixels that are behind these blocks. The other pixels are rendered normally. It seems to happen from a certain distance (between 15 and 20 meters). I've experienced that bug for some other entities and blocks, and it seems the bug only applies with sheep.

I was able to reproduce this. My settings were fast graphics and 100% entity distance. Additionally, if you are close to a block and you have your cursor aimed at the block so that the block outline renders, then the sheep's wool renders too, but if you look away from the block, then the sheep's wool stops rendering again.
